School handbooks are comprehensive guides provided by educational institutions that outline the policies, rules, expectations, and resources available to students, parents, and staff. They serve as a reference for understanding school procedures, behavioral standards, academic requirements, and available support services. Typically distributed at the start of the academic year, they aim to ensure clear communication and promote a positive school environment.
Key Features
- Detailed policies on attendance, discipline, and dress code
- Academic guidelines and grading systems
- Information on extracurricular activities and clubs
- Resources for student support and counseling
- Emergency procedures and safety protocols
- Contact information for staff and administration
- Code of conduct and behavioral expectations
